Land grading services involve the process of shaping and leveling the ground on a property to achieve proper drainage, stability, and a suitable foundation for construction or landscaping projects. This work typ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low areas, and contouring the land to ensure water flows away from structures and prevents pooling or erosion.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to achieve precise slopes and elevations, which are essential for the long-term integrity and usability of the property.
One of the primary issues land grading addresses is improper drainage, which can lead to water accumulation around foundations, basements, or landscaping features. Poorly graded land may cause soil erosion, flooding, or damage to structures over time. By properly grading a property, these problems are mitigated, helping to protect investments and improve the overall safety and functionality of the outdoor space. Effective grading also supports the installation of lawns, gardens, driveways, and other outdoor features by creating a stable and well-drained base.
Properties that commonly utilize land grading services include residential homes, commercial buildings, industrial sites, and large-scale development projects. Residential properties often require grading to prepare yards for landscaping or to correct existing drainage issues. Commercial and industrial sites may need extensive grading to ensure proper site drainage, foundation stability, and compliance with construction standards. Larger properties, such as parks or sports fields, also benefit from professional grading to create level, safe, and functional outdoor environments.

Typical Land Grading Costs - The cost for land grading services generally 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the project size and complexity. Smaller residential projects might be closer to $1,200, while larger commercial sites can exceed $4,500.
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s vary based on soil condition, site accessibility, and the amount of earthwork required. For example, a straightforward yard grading might cost around $1,500, whereas extensive grading for a new development could be over $6,000.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Land grading typically costs between $0.50 and $2.00 per square foot. For a 10,000-square-foot lot, prices could range from $5,000 to $20,000 depending on the scope of work.
Additional Expenses - Extra charges may include site preparation, drainage system installation, or utility adjustments. These additional services can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the overall cost, based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is land grading? Land grading involves leveling or sloping the land surface to improve drainage, prepare for construction, or enhance landscape aesthetics.
Why is land grading important? Proper land grading helps prevent water pooling, protects structures from water damage, and creates a stable foundation for development projects.
How do I find local land grading contractors? Contact local construction or landscaping service providers who specialize in land leveling and grading services in Mishawaka, IN and nearby areas.
What factors influence land grading costs? Costs can vary based on the size of the area, soil conditions, grading complexity, and accessibility of the site.
How long does land grading typically take? The duration depends on the scope of the project, but most residential grading jobs can be completed within a few days to a week.
